One of these companies is Beat, focused on mobility solutions development, which launched the “Beat Zero”<\/a> service at the beginning of 2022. The initiative will have more affordable fares than Teslas, and more similar to traditional cab prices.<\/p>\n\n\n\n <\/p>\n\n\n\n The difference in this case is that Beat owns the entire EV fleet and drivers are on the company’s payroll. An estimated 700 people are involved in the operation, <\/p>\n\n\n\n including drivers and administrative staff.<\/p>\n\n\n\n <\/p>\n\n\n\n According to data from the Greek-based organization, those using this service can save up to 19,600g of carbon for every 100 kilometers they travel.<\/p>\n\n\n\n <\/p>\n\n\n\nChinese Car with Great Technology<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n
